Rayovac batteries at Specsavers

Mar 27th, 2008 | By Steve | Category: Buying a hearing aid

Specsavers are selling boxes of 60 hearing aid batteries ( 10 x 6 packs ) for 18 pounds.
The batteries are branded as Specsaver’s own but they are actually Rayovac – so you can rely on them being of good quality.
